Understanding Perinatal Stem Cells

Perinatal stem cells, harvested from the umbilical cord blood right after birth, are among the youngest and most potent stem cells available. They hold incredible therapeutic promise due to their pristine nature and ability to differentiate into a variety of cell types. Researchers and clinicians are particularly interested in these stem cells for their potential in regenerative medicine.

Umbilical cord blood is a rich source of Hematopoietic Stem Cells (HSCs) and Mesenchymal Stem Cells (MSCs). These stem cells are highly versatile and have been studied for a range of applications including the regeneration of damaged tissues and the treatment of various diseases. The Paracrine Effect and Healing Proteins

A significant advantage of perinatal stem cells is their Paracrine Effect. This effect encompasses the release of a multitude of growth factors, cytokines, and other signaling molecules which play a crucial role in promoting tissue repair and reducing inflammation. The paracrine action of these cells supports the body's intrinsic healing processes, making them a key focal point in regenerative therapies.

An important aspect of this process involves Proteins stimulating cell growth and healing. These proteins are vital for cellular communication, promoting the proliferation and differentiation of adjacent cells.
